Slow Cooker Red Beans and Rice is perfect for Mari Gras or anytime you're craving spicy, hearty Cajun food!

Ingredients
- 1 pound dry kidney beans
- 1 yellow onion, diced
- 3 cloves garlic, grated or minced
- 3 celery stalks, diced
- 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
- 1/2 teaspoon ground sage
- 1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per, or to taste
- 1/2 cup diced green chiles
- 3 bay leaves
- 3 sprigs fresh thyme
- 4 cups low sodium chicken broth
- 2 cups water
- 1 pound smoked turkey sausage, sliced about 1/2 inch in thickness
- Hot sauce, kosher salt and fresh ground black pepper to taste
- Sliced green onions and rice for serving

Instructions
- Rinse the beans under cool, running water. Place them in a large bowl or pot and cover with several inches of water. Let sit overnight. Drain the beans and add them into the slow cooker.
- In a large skillet sauté the onions and celery for several minutes. Add in the garlic, smoked paprika, sage and cayenne pepper. Season with salt and pepper and sauté another 30 seconds. Pour the mixture into the slow cooker.
- Add the remaining ingredients minus the sausage to the slow cooker, stir everything together, cover with the lid and cook for 8-10 hours on low or until the beans are tender. Use a potato masher and mash some of the beans. This will help thicken the sauce for a creamier consistency.
- Stir in the slices of sausage and cook for another 15-30 minutes. At this point you can either serve it or cool and refrigerate it overnight. Serve over rice topped with sliced green onions.
Notes
- I prefer to make this a day or two before serving. Doing this enhances the flavors and also helps it thicken.
- Nutritional data doesn't include the rice.
